Designing training environments that foster creativity, calculated risk taking, and tactical experimentation among players.
An evidence-based guide to shaping practice spaces, routines, and feedback loops that cultivate creative problem-solving, measured daring, and adaptive decision-making within team sports.

Creating training environments that nurture creativity starts with structuring practice as a deliberate laboratory. Coaches design sessions around problem-based drills that require players to improvise while constrained by clear goals and rules. Rather than prescribing a single solution, facilitators encourage participants to trade options, test hypotheses, and learn from missteps in real time. The result is a culture where curiosity is valued and experimentation is rewarded, not punished. Beyond drills, the environment includes accessible equipment, versatile spaces, and time for reflective discussion. When athletes see creativity as a core skill, they begin to approach unfamiliar situations with confidence rather than hesitation, expanding their tactical repertoire.
Equally important is balancing structure with freedom. A well-crafted practice sets boundaries—field size, rules of engagement, and scoring systems—that guide actions without prohibiting inventive responses. Players learn to interpret possession pressure, space occupancy, and tempo as cues for adaptive choices. In such settings, coaches act as curators of challenge, not merely instructors. They provide prompts that spark exploration, monitor cognitive load to prevent overload, and celebrate successful experimentation. The environment thus becomes a living curriculum where tactical experimentation is embedded in daily routines, leading to more versatile players who can pivot rapidly under pressure during actual competition.
Building variability, feedback, and reflective practice into routines.
Tactical experimentation thrives when feedback is timely, specific, and framed as guidance rather than judgment. Short debriefs after each drill highlight what worked, what didn’t, and why it mattered for next attempts. Players are invited to articulate their reasoning and assess the consequences of different decisions. This reflective practice strengthens metacognition and reduces fear of risk-taking. Coaches model curiosity by asking open questions and acknowledging clever adaptations, even when outcomes are imperfect. Over time, consistent feedback loops help athletes recognize patterns, recognize hidden opportunities, and build a flexible playbook that translates across positions and game situations.

Another pillar is variability in practice design. Regularly rotating roles, changing constraints, and introducing imperfect information forces players to read the game more accurately. When athletes confront uncertainty, they learn to rely on process rather than chase flawless outcomes. This emphasis on process teaches better decision cadence, anticipation, and communication. The coach’s skill lies in steering learners toward optimal risk damping and creative escalation, balancing daring ideas with prudent execution. By embedding variability, teams develop resilience and the ability to improvise without abandoning strategic core principles.
Integrating space design, feedback, and safety into training.
Creating psychological safety is essential for sustained creativity. Athletes must feel free to propose unconventional ideas without fear of embarrassment or punishment. This requires a culture where mistakes are reframed as stepping stones toward mastery. Coaches establish norms that encourage listening, give credit for useful contributions, and normalize vulnerability as part of growth. In such climates, players are more willing to test daring strategies, share novel solutions, and push beyond their comfort zones. Psychological safety also reduces performance anxiety, enabling sharper perception, quicker adaptation, and more cohesive teamwork.

The design of practice space communicates expectations as well. Visual cues, color-coded zones, and clearly marked targets guide attention to critical variables. Movement pathways become readable maps that help teammates anticipate options and coordinate actions. Access to diverse equipment supports creative experimentation: lighter balls for rapid decision making, larger goals to encourage spatial creativity, or small-sided formats that intensify decision density. A well-planned environment signals that exploration is valued, while consistent scoring incentives link curiosity with measurable progress, reinforcing the link between creative risk-taking and tangible achievement.
Balancing risk, safety, and intent in practice ecosystems.
Player autonomy should extend beyond the drill to influence scheduling and task selection. When athletes have a voice in choosing what problems to tackle, motivation increases and commitment deepens. Allowing a degree of self-direction helps players connect practice with real-game challenges, fostering ownership of learning. Autonomy also reduces resistance to feedback because participants view coaching input as guidance that supports their chosen path. The balance remains clear: autonomy without chaos, creativity governed by purpose, and experimentation aligned with team objectives and standards.
Safety considerations cannot be overlooked in the pursuit of creativity. Progressive exposure to risk, with appropriate supervision and protective measures, teaches players to gauge hazard levels and respond calmly under pressure. A well-regulated environment teaches judgment about when to push beyond comfort zones and when to pull back. Clear expectations regarding sportsmanship, boundary setting, and risk management ensure that bold ideas stay productive rather than reckless. When safety is integrated with creativity, teams learn to innovate within a framework that protects players and sustains long-term development.

Leadership, culture, and routines that sustain creativity over time.
Measuring the impact of creative training requires thoughtful metrics beyond wins and losses. Coaches track cognitive engagement, decision speed, and variability of responses under pressure. Video review, paired with qualitative notes, helps identify moments of insight and miscalculation alike. The aim is to recognize growth in players’ problem-solving processes, not just the outcomes of isolated plays. Regular assessments encourage continued curiosity and accountability, reinforcing that improvement comes from deliberate practice. By documenting progress, teams create a tangible record of how creativity and calculated risk translate into better in-game decisions.
Finally, leadership alignment shapes the success of training environments. Managers, captains, and mentors should model the habits they want to cultivate—curiosity, adaptive thinking, respectful debate, and disciplined risk assessment. When leadership visibly prizes creative experimentation, players mirror those values in their actions. Shared language about tactics, experimentation, and learning rhythms creates coherence across staff and players. In practice, leadership acts as the keystone that holds together the culture, the curriculum, and the daily routines that sustain long-term creative growth.
A sustainable approach to creativity emphasizes consistent routines that become second nature. Regularly scheduled micro-sessions—brief, focused explorations of a single concept—can accumulate substantial gains without overwhelming players. This cadence supports steady improvement while preserving enthusiasm. Moreover, players benefit from cross-training and exposure to different roles, which broadens their strategic horizon and reduces dependence on a single solution set. In a well-rounded program, strength, endurance, and tactical studies reinforce each other, creating a holistic environment where creativity is inseparable from the core competencies of the sport.
In the end, designing training environments that encourage creativity, calculated risk taking, and tactical experimentation is an ongoing, collaborative process. It requires deliberate planning, adaptive coaching, and a climate of trust. When athletes feel empowered to test ideas, learn from mistakes, and refine strategies with teammates, they develop a sharper sense of the game and a stronger sense of themselves as players. The payoff is measurable: sharper decisions under pressure, more dynamic collaboration, and a culture that sustains innovation across seasons and generations.
